A patient is in the diuretic phase of AKI. During this phase, what is the nurse mainly concerned about?

a. Assessing for hypertension and fluid overload
b. Monitoring for hypovolemia and electrolyte loss
c. Adjusting the dosage of diuretic medications
d. Balancing diuretic therapy with intake


Answer: b. Monitoring for hypovolemia and electrolyte loss
